I dunno how that's possible...in West Jefferson NC we just have found out that another 15% of hourly staff are getting layed off. This is on top of 2 other previous layoffs we have already had this year, the 1st was 10%, and 2nd was 15%. So with this 3rd one, we've lost 40% of our shop due to the 737 max issues, and COVID, all within 8 months.
